Cobbler Finds New Home in Flossmoor
Ricardo Tovar and wife Shareese were left to find a new storefront, after their previous home in Lincoln Mall closed.
Shareese Tovar calls their new home in Flossmoor a miracle.
Tovar and husband Ricardo found themselves scrambling for a home for their shoe repair business, after learning that their previous location at Lincoln Mall was to close Jan. 7.
“Each place kept falling through,” Tovar told Patch. Many potential locations had quirks or issues that deemed it not quite the right fit for the couple’s five-year-old business. Until they found the former Poppies location, at 1036 Sterling Ave.

“When we closed Wednesday, we had a place two days later,” Tovar said. “It worked out perfectly.”
Ricardo Tovar brings 30 years of experience as a cobbler and maker of custom shoes, boots, and handbags, with the shop bearing his name. Prior to their location at Lincoln Mall, Tovar practiced his craft from their home in Matteson. He is skilled in wingtip, leather, and alligator skin footwear.

“He’s an expert,” Shareese Tovar said.
The signage on the store still reads Poppies, but the Tovars are open for business. They can be reached at 708-898-0367. Hours are Monday through Friday, 10 a.m. to 6 p.m., Saturday 10 a.m. to 5 p.m.
